WP Discourse Kommentare werden nur verknüpft

Hallo,

ich habe WP Discourse auf meiner Website eingerichtet, um die Kommentare zu Beiträgen zu übernehmen. Ich habe es so eingestellt, dass alle Kommentare angezeigt werden, aber es wird standardmäßig nur ein Link zu den Kommentaren auf Discourse angezeigt. Ich habe zu verschiedenen Standard-Themes gewechselt, um zu prüfen, ob es sich um ein Theme-Problem handelt, aber das Problem besteht weiterhin.

Haben Sie eine Idee, wie ich das beheben/anpassen kann?

Vielen Dank,
Ray

Admin:

Kommentarbereich auf der Beitragsseite:

Danke für den Bericht! Könntest du mir bitte mitteilen, welche Version von Discourse dein Forum verwendet und welche Version des WP Discourse-Plugins du nutzt?

Klar, ich verwende Discourse 2.6.0.beta1 und das Plugin ist Version 2.1.0.

Lass mich wissen, wie ich helfen kann. : )

Danke!
Ray

Könntest du versuchen, auf WP Discourse 2.1.1 zu aktualisieren, und mir mitteilen, ob das Problem dadurch behoben wird?

Ich weiß, wo im Code das Problem auftritt, konnte es aber bisher noch nicht reproduzieren. Wir werden das Problem lösen, aber es könnte sein, dass dies erst nach Montag geschieht.

Gerade aktualisiert, und das Problem scheint weiterhin zu bestehen.

Kein Stress, aber lass es mich wissen, falls du möchtest, dass ich etwas anderes versuche.

Ich wünsche dir ein schönes Wochenende!

Ray

Bisher habe ich nur einen Weg gefunden, das Problem zu reproduzieren: einen Beitrag auf Discourse veröffentlichen und dann das Thema in eine PM auf Discourse umwandeln. Discourse-PMs zeigen folgendes Symbol an:

Ist es möglich, dass der Beitrag, auf den Sie verlinken möchten, in eine PM auf Discourse umgewandelt wurde? Wenn ja, dann ist das Anzeigen des Kommentarlinks das erwartete Verhalten. Falls das Thema nicht in eine PM umgewandelt wurde, werde ich weiterhin versuchen, einen Weg zu finden, das Problem zu reproduzieren.

Haben Sie bereits versucht, mehr als einen Beitrag auf Discourse zu veröffentlichen? Wenn ja, tritt das Problem bei allen Beiträgen auf?

Simon,

Sie wurden nicht in PMs umgewandelt. Ich habe mehrere Testbeiträge mit anschließenden Kommentaren veröffentlicht, und alle verlinken nur auf die Diskussion, statt die Kommentare anzuzeigen. Das ist definitiv eine seltsame Sache.

Gerne gebe ich dir Zugang zu meiner Einrichtung, falls du sie brauchst; sie ist ohnehin noch nicht live.

Lass mich bitte wissen, was ich sonst noch tun kann.

Vielen Dank,
Ray

P.S. Mir ist auch aufgefallen, dass reguläre WordPress-Kommentare (die vor der Verbindung mit Discourse gepostet wurden) überhaupt nicht geladen werden, obwohl ich Discourse so eingestellt habe, dass sie angezeigt werden sollen. Es erscheint lediglich die Meldung: „Kommentare sind für diesen Beitrag derzeit nicht verfügbar.“

Ich versuche weiterhin, das Problem nachzuvollziehen, habe aber bisher keinen Erfolg. Könnten Sie versuchen, „Benutzerdefinierte Felder

Okay, ich habe benutzerdefinierte Felder aktiviert, und du hast recht – es gibt keinen Eintrag für benutzerdefinierte Felder namens discourse_comments_raw (obwohl andere Discourse-Einträge vorhanden sind). Weder Name noch Wert.

Der Link zur Kommentaranzahl am unteren Rand des Beitrags wird aktualisiert, also funktioniert das zumindest (BTW: Wenn du oben im Beitrag auf den Kommentarlink klickst, springt die Seite nicht nach unten zu den Kommentaren).

Ich kann bestätigen, dass der API-Schlüssel für alle Benutzer freigegeben und global ist. Ich habe zur Sicherheit einen komplett neuen erstellt, aber das Verhalten wiederholt sich.

Lass mich wissen, wie ich weiterhelfen kann, um das Problem zu debuggen.

Ich schätze deine umfassende Aufarbeitung des Problems sehr. : )

PS: Ich habe alle Plugins außer Discourse deaktiviert, nur zur Sicherheit, aber nichts hat sich geändert.

Könntest du versuchen, auf WP Discourse Version 2.1.2 zu aktualisieren? Diese Version sollte das Problem beheben, das dazu führte, dass der Kommentarl link angezeigt wurde.

Das hat gewirkt!

Danke für deine Bemühungen, dieses Problem endlich zu lösen, Simon : )

Ray